3D
Format [back
to top]
3D means there are 3 divisions in the class.
This is a fair way to allow competitors of all skill levels
to compete together and have a chance to take home some of
the prize money. The first division winner is the rider that
posts the fastest time of the class. The second division winner
is the posted time that's 1 second back from the 1st division
winner. Likewise the third division winner is 2 full seconds
back from the first division winning time. There are usually
3 placings within each division. If there is a large number
of entries, a 4D format will be used. The 4D format is very
similar to the 3D format except it includes one more division
. In the 4D format, the second division winner is a half second
back from the fastest first division time, the third division
winner is a full second back from the fastest first division
time and the fourth division winner is two seconds back from
the fastest first division time.
Entering Classes
[back
to top]
To enter the shows at Wildwood Manor Ranch,
you must have a horse or you may borrow one of Wildwood's
for a nominal fee. Come to the ranch about 1 hr before the
show begins to get your horse ready, fill out an entry form
and pay your fees to the show secretary. Then make sure you
listen to the announcer as each class and running order is
called. When you hear your name, it's your turn to enter the
arena and make your run.
To enter shows at any other location, please
arrive early to allow time to have your horses ready, register
with the show secretary and pay your entry & office/arena
fees.
